Floods and tornadoes cause damage in US Gulf states

Some regions of Louisiana and Alabama have been under tornado alert as storms hit the region.

A flash flood warning was in effect earlier on Wednesday in northern Texas. The National Weather Service alerted residents in New Orleans not to drive due to the storms coming in from the Gulf of Mexico.

10 April 2024